What's The Definition Of Recumbent?

[adj] lying down; in a position of comfort or rest

Synonyms | Synonyms for Recumbent: accumbent | decumbent | reclining | unerect

Recumbent In Webster's Dictionary

\Re*cum"bent\ (-bet), a. [L. recumbens, -entis, p. pr. of recumbere. See {Recumb}, {Incumbent}.] Leaning; reclining; lying; as, the recumbent posture of the Romans at their meals. Hence, figuratively; Resting; inactive; idle. -- {Re*cum"bent*ly}, adv.
